beer | a general name for alcoholic beverages made by fermenting a cereal (or mixture of cereals) flavored with hops |
draft beer draught beer | beer drawn from a keg |
Munich beer Munchener | a dark lager produced in Munich since the th century, has a distinctive taste of malt |
bock bock beer | a very strong lager traditionally brewed in the fall and aged through the winter for consumption in the spring |
lager lager beer | a general term for beer made with bottom fermenting yeast (usually by decoction mashing), originally it was brewed in March or April and matured until September |
light beer | lager with reduced alcohol content |
Weissbier white beer wheat beer | a general name for beers made from wheat by top fermentation, usually very pale and cloudy and effervescent |
porter porter's beer | a very dark sweet ale brewed from roasted unmalted barley |
near beer | drink that resembles beer but with less than percent alcohol |
ginger beer | carbonated slightly alcoholic drink flavored with fermented ginger |
sake saki rice beer | Japanese alcoholic beverage made from fermented rice, usually served hot |
root beer float | an iceream soda made with ice cream floating in root beer |
birch beer | carbonated drink containing an extract from bark of birch trees |
root beer | carbonated drink containing extracts of roots and herbs |
spruce beer | a brew made by fermenting molasses and other sugars with the sap of spruce trees (sometimes with malt) |
